Blockchain Security

Quick Start

  1. Download and decompile contracts (source or bytecode)
  2. Map storage layout and identify privileged operations
  3. Check for delegatecall, CREATE address prediction, reentrancy, access control
  4. Deploy exploit contracts via web3.py or cast/forge
  5. Verify win condition (isSolved/flag endpoint)
